Question
A man received Rs. 15,000 as a bonus. He spent 25% of this
on groceries, 10% of the remaining on clothes, and 20% of the remaining on travel. What amount of bonus is left with him after all these expenses?Solution
ATQ,
Money spent on groceries = 0.25 × 15000 = Rs. 3,750
Amount left = 15000 – 3750 = Rs. 11,250
Money spent on clothes = 0.10 × 11250 = Rs. 1,125
Money left = 11250 – 1125 = Rs. 10,125
Money spent on travel = 0.20 × 10125 = Rs. 2,025
So, the final bonus left with the man = 10125 – 2025 = Rs. 8,100
